Canada
A baby bonus was introduced in Canada following the second world war. A family allowance scheme known as the "baby bonus" made regular monthly payments of $5 to $8 to all parents of children under 16.
In 1988, the Quebec government introduced the Allowance for Newborn Children that paid up to $8,000 to a family after the birth of a child.
Today, the Canada Child Tax Benefit (CCTB) is but one of many child and family benefits offered by the government of Canada.
